Cant run a Wad?
im having trouble running a wad called atomiattack. ive tried zdoom, qzdoom, and gzdoom, and none of them would detect it as a .wad file. can zdoom not run user created .wads or something?

Re: Cant run a Wad?
If all you're doing is putting the .wad file into the folder, that's not how it works - the dialog box that appears when you run ZDoom (and derivatives) is only designed to show IWADs, i.e. base game data files. This page may be of help to you: https://zdoom.org/wiki/Installation_and ... n_of_ZDoom
